Taking that situation and putting a brighter spin on it, is the Trash Can that can make a difference. Every month, Journey partners with an organization in town that is trying to make a difference in our community. In that month we collect items in our trash can and then give them to the organization so that they can make a difference in the people they see on a regular basis.
